Figure 2From: Dispersion of hyperenhancement in late gadolinium enhancement cardiovascular magnetic resonance measured with Moran's I is associated with a decrement in LVEF 6 months after cardiotoxic chemotherapyLongitudinal measurements of left ventricular ejection fraction (LVEF, Panel A), late gadolinium enhancement signal intensity (LGE-SI, Panel B), and LGE-SI pattern (Moran's I, Panel C) measured with 1.5T cardiovascular magnetic resonance prior to chemotherapy administration (month 0) and again 3 and 6 months after administration of cardiotoxic chemotherapy. Mean values ± standard deviation shown in each panel. Significant differences from baseline by paired t-tests with p-values<0.05 indicated by (*); p-value listed in each panel is for analysis of trend using one-way ANOVA.Back to article page
